10.  OLD BUSINESS:  Introduction and reconsideration of:
A. ORDINANCE NO. 2004-34
An ordinance amending sections of part Five, General Offense Code, to authorize the abatement of 
nuisance animals from within the Village.  3rd reading.  Motion to table Ordinance No. 2004-34 was 
made by Braverman; seconded by Kluter.
Ayes:	Braverman     Kluter     Weisblatt     Perry
No:		Bram

B. ORDINANCE NO. 2004-37
An ordinance granting a variance from section 1161.06 of the Orange Village Codified Ordinances to 
the Signature Sign Company for the property at 3755 Orange Place to permit certain signage.  3rd reading.



*Planning & Zoning defeated the motion to recommend passage of Ordinance No. 2004-37 on 12-21-04.
*Signature Sign Co. withdrew its request for a variance on 1-20-05.
Motion to approve Ordinance No. 2004-37 was made by Braverman; seconded by Weisblatt.
Ayes:	None
No:		Bram     Braverman     Kluter     Weisblatt     Perry

Ordinance No. 2004-37 was defeated.

C. ORDINANCE NO. 2005-1
An ordinance engaging Weltman, Weinberg & Reis Co. L.P.A., as special counsel to collect certain debts, 
and engage in any legal proceedings related thereto, on behalf of Orange Village and declaring an emergency.  
2nd reading.

D. ORDINANCE NO. 2005-3
An ordinance authorizing the Mayor to enter into a collective bargaining agreement with the Fraternal Order of 
Police and declaring an emergency.  2nd reading.
